Education Minister calls for swift investigation into fire outbreak at Labone Senior High School

The Minister of Education, Haruna Iddrisu has issued a directive for swift investigations into a fire outbreak that occurred during late hours of Sunday, March 16, 2025 at the Labone Senior High School in Accra.

Sources explain that the fierce fire gutted three dormitory blocks in the school, resulting in the damage of school property and student belongings.

No casualties have been recorded so far as the Ghana National Fire Service rushed in to quench the fire. The GNFS are still investigating the possible cause of the fire.

The Minister during his visit to the school on Monday, March 17 2025, morning expressed his sympathy with affected students and assured them to be expectant of government’s swift response. “We know how distressing that can be for you. I have asked a team to move in quickly, make an assessment and government will do what is needful and appropriate. So be assured that in a matter of days some intervention will come to see the refitting of the girls’ dormitory.”

He also shared plans of possible deliberations between him and the school authorities to construct a new dormitory block.
